PARKTOWN, South Africa Orlando Pirates coach Ruud Krol and Kaizer Chiefs striker Knowledge Musona
have won the Absa Premiership Coach of the Month and Absa Premiership Player of the month for the
December and January period. The announcement was made at the Premier Soccer League offices in
Parktown on Monday.

Washington, D.C. (April 25, 2011) - The D.C. United Youth Academy Under-17 team
earned sixth place in the prestigious 2011 AEGON Future Cup in Amsterdam over the past weekend, as
Patrick Foss scored four goals to earn the tournament's Golden Boot award.
The squad managed a 1-3-0 record, but gained valuable experience playing against a some of the top
youth academies in the world, including Bayern Munich, Ajax Cape Town, and tournament champion, RSC
Anderlecht.
Orlando Pirates sneaked the South African ABSA Premiership title by virtue of goal
difference and cruelly denied Ajax Cape Town the championship in the process.
With two points separating Ajax, who led the table going into the final round of matches, from
the Pirates it seemed that the former would clinch their maiden title, especially given that they
were at home to Maritzburg United who were languishing in the bottom half of the table.

The 2011-12 South African football championship kicked off this weekend with defending champions
Orlando Pirates celebrating an away win at Black Leopards while there were also wins for Kaizer
Chiefs, Moroka Swallows, Bloemfontein Celtic and Platinum Stars. Three matches out of eight were
drawn this weekend including the two Sunday fixtures.
